If you are interested in using the energy that flows freely from the sun, you should check out solar systems, which can be installed in any home. Whether your state gets tons of direct sunlight does not matter, as this type of solution works in any area. Of course, this is a big decision to make since it can be costly upfront, so think about a few details that are important before you hire a company to install this product for you.

One of the most popular benefits of solar systems is that they usually end up saving homeowners money on their utility bills every month. This is because this type of system can heat or cool down both water and the entire home, which means that there is less work for the heater, air conditioner, and water heater to do. Thus, less electricity from the utility company is used, as the sun does a lot of the work instead. Solar systems need the right selection for the site as they cannot just be placed anywhere in a dwelling. Site selection is key. You want to choose an area of your home that gets on average five to six hours (or preferably more) of sunlight per day.
